Life Story John Roberts
When John Roberts was born in 1854 in Llysfaen, Carnarvonshire, his father, Thomas, was 48 and his mother, Anne, was 40. He lived in Llysfaen, Carnarvonshire, Wales, for more than 60 years from 1861 to 1921. He married Mary Hughes on 8th December, 1877, in Llysfaen, Carnarvonshire. They had nine children in 22 years.

Jack Roberts Life Story
When Robert John Roberts [He was always called Jack] was born on 5th May, 1899, in Carnarvon, Carnarvonshire, his father, John, was 45 and his mother, Mary, was 43. He had one son with Norah Mary Hayward. He died on 25th July, 1965, in Birmingham, Warwickshire, at the age of 66, and was buried there.Birth: 5th May, 1899.
